Path resurfacing services involve restoring the top layer of a damaged or worn pathway to improve its appearance and functionality. This process typically includes cleaning the existing surface, repairing any underlying issues, and applying a fresh layer of asphalt or concrete. Resurfacing can help address common problems such as cracks, potholes, and uneven surfaces, making walkways, driveways, or patios safer and more visually appealing. It is a practical solution for property owners looking to extend the lifespan of their existing pathways without the need for complete replacement.

This service is especially effective for solving issues caused by weather exposure, regular use, or age-related deterioration. Over time, pathways may develop cracks that can expand and lead to further damage if left unaddressed. Potholes can form, creating tripping hazards or damage to vehicles. Uneven surfaces may also develop, making walking or driving uncomfortable and unsafe. Path resurfacing helps to smooth out these imperfections, restore structural integrity, and prevent more cost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Path Resurfacing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Arvada, CO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or patching or surface repairs usually range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of surface damage and area size.

Surface Resurfacing - Resurfacing projects often cost between $1,000 and $3,000, covering larger areas or moderate surface restoration. Most projects land in this range, with fewer reaching the higher end for extensive work.

Full Resurfacing - Complete resurfacing of a driveway or parking lot can cost from $3,500 to $7,000, depending on size and surface condition.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range but are less common.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ire surface typically starts around $8,000 and can go beyond $15,000 for extensive, high-traffic areas. Many projects in this category are customized based on surface size and material choices.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is path resurfacing? Path resurfacing involves applying a new surface layer to existing walkways or driveways to improve their appearance and durability.

Which types of surfaces can be resurfaced? Local contractors can handle resurfacing for concrete, asphalt, and other paved surfaces commonly found in residential and commercial properties.

How do I know if my path needs resurfacing? Signs include cracks, uneven surfaces, fading, or surface deterioration that affect safety and aesthetics.

What are common resurfacing methods used by local service providers? Techniques include overlaying with new concrete or asphalt, sealing, or applying specialized resurfacing compounds to restore the surface.

Can resurfacing extend the lifespan of my existing path? Yes, proper resurfacing can help protect the underlying material and prolong the usability of the surface.
